Output 3e12b39de41154d221c64faa758deaaa30a19e69976d89c3640a66b782c41674:117

value
68608
script pubkey
OP_0 OP_PUSHBYTES_20 883bc133cc2343853b1a15556f8d5fe1d046fd78
address
bc1q3qauzv7vydpc2wc6z42klr2lu8gydltcfrl25j
transaction
3e12b39de41154d221c64faa758deaaa30a19e69976d89c3640a66b782c41674